Patents by Inventor Ziad Asghar
Ziad Asghar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20250209834Abstract: Systems, methods, and non-transitory media are provided for a vehicle and mobile device interface for vehicle occupant assistance. An example method can include determining, based on one or more images of an interior portion of a vehicle, a pose of a mobile device relative to a coordinate system of the vehicle; determine a state of an occupant of the vehicle; and send, to the vehicle, data indicating the state of the occupant and the pose of the mobile device relative to the coordinate system of the vehicle.Type: ApplicationFiled: March 13, 2025Publication date: June 26, 2025Inventors: Ziad ASGHAR, Wesley James HOLLAND, Seyfullah Halit OGUZ, Bala RAMASAMY, Leonid SHEYNBLAT
-
Publication number: 20250131020Abstract: Various embodiments include systems and methods for improving the user experience with LXMs. A computing device may be configured to receive a user prompt, observe user responses to an output received from a LXM in response to a prompt that is at least partially based on the user's prompt, and take an action to improve the user's experience with the LXM based on the observed user response.Type: ApplicationFiled: October 23, 2023Publication date: April 24, 2025Inventors: Vikram GUPTA, Wesley James HOLLAND, Ziad ASGHAR, Vinesh SUKUMAR, Roland MEMISEVIC
-
Publication number: 20250131024Abstract: Various embodiments include systems and methods for generating a prompt for a generative artificial intelligence (AI) models. A processing system including at least one processor may be configured to recognize a user of the computing device, obtain user context information from a source of physical context information in the computing device, receive a user prompt for the large generative AI model (LXM), select a user profile from among a plurality of user profiles based on the user, the user context information and the user prompt, generate an enhanced prompt based on the user prompt and information included in the selected user profile, and submit the enhanced prompt to the LXM.Type: ApplicationFiled: October 23, 2023Publication date: April 24, 2025Inventors: Vikram GUPTA, Ziad ASGHAR, Wesley James HOLLAND, Vinesh SUKUMAR, Khaled Helmi EL-MALEH, Roland MEMISEVIC
-
Patent number: 12277779Abstract: Systems, methods, and non-transitory media are provided for a vehicle and mobile device interface for vehicle occupant assistance. An example method can include determining, based on one or more images of an interior portion of a vehicle, a pose of a mobile device relative to a coordinate system of the vehicle; determine a state of an occupant of the vehicle; and send, to the vehicle, data indicating the state of the occupant and the pose of the mobile device relative to the coordinate system of the vehicle.Type: GrantFiled: October 6, 2021Date of Patent: April 15, 2025Assignee: QUALCOMM IncorporatedInventors: Ziad Asghar, Wesley James Holland, Seyfullah Halit Oguz, Bala Ramasamy, Leonid Sheynblat
-
Publication number: 20250054230Abstract: Systems and techniques are provided for conditioning virtual representatives. For example, a method can include obtaining, by a conditioning engine, a baseline model for a virtual representative; obtaining, by the conditioning engine, one or more conditioning inputs configured to condition an action in one or more multi-user experiences of the virtual representative; generating, based on the baseline model and the one or more conditioning inputs configured to condition an action in one or more multi-user experiences of the virtual representative, a conditioned model for the virtual representative; and outputting the conditioned model for the virtual representative.Type: ApplicationFiled: August 10, 2023Publication date: February 13, 2025Inventors: Wesley James HOLLAND, Ziad ASGHAR, Daniel Jared SINDER, Khaled Helmi EL-MALEH, Vikram GUPTA, Seyfullah Halit OGUZ, Miran CHUN, Fatih Murat PORIKLI, Jian SHEN, Vinesh SUKUMAR
-
Publication number: 20250055717Abstract: Systems and techniques are provided for coordinating multi-user experiences. For example, a process can include obtaining a plurality of settings associated with a plurality of multi-user experience participants. The plurality of settings includes one or more arbitrated settings and one or more non-arbitrated settings. The process can include arbitrating, by a settings arbitration engine, the one or more arbitrated settings to generate one or more adjusted settings for each arbitrated setting. The process can include generating, by an experience adaptation engine, an adapted multi-user experience, wherein the adapted multi-user experience is configured to enforce the one or more adjusted settings for each arbitrated setting.Type: ApplicationFiled: August 10, 2023Publication date: February 13, 2025Inventors: Wesley James HOLLAND, Ziad ASGHAR, Jian SHEN, Miran CHUN, Daniel Jared SINDER, Vikram GUPTA, Khaled Helmi EL-MALEH, Vinesh SUKUMAR
-
Publication number: 20250054212Abstract: Systems and techniques are provided for adapting digital content. For example, a process can include obtaining a digital content comprising a default configuration for outputting the digital content to a device; outputting, by the device, the digital content based on the default configuration for outputting the digital content. The process can include obtaining, from a monitoring engine, content interaction information associated with outputting, by the device, the digital content based on the default configuration for outputting the digital content. The monitoring engine is configured to monitor one or more interactions between one or more users of the device and the digital content. The process can include generating, based on the content interaction information, a content adaptation for the digital content. The process can include outputting, by the device, the content adaptation for the digital content.Type: ApplicationFiled: August 10, 2023Publication date: February 13, 2025Inventors: Wesley James HOLLAND, Ziad ASGHAR, Seyfullah Halit OGUZ, Daniel Jared SINDER, Vikram GUPTA, Khaled Helmi EL-MALEH, Vinesh SUKUMAR
-
Publication number: 20240305962Abstract: receiving, by a control system, client device information from one or more client devices and transmitting, by the control system, sensor data request information to the one or more client devices. The client device information may indicate at least client device type information and client device sensor information. The sensor data request information may indicate one or more requested sensor data types and one or more requested sensor data transmission parameters. The one or more requested sensor data transmission parameters may indicate one or more threshold parameters for requested sensor data transmission, one or more variance parameters for requested sensor data transmission, or a combination thereof. Some examples may involve receiving, by the control system, sensor data from the one or more client devices based, at least in part, on the one or more requested sensor data transmission parameters.Type: ApplicationFiled: March 9, 2023Publication date: September 12, 2024Inventors: Justin MCGLOIN, Joel LINSKY, Ziad ASGHAR, Vinesh SUKUMAR
-
Publication number: 20240105206Abstract: Certain aspects of the present disclosure provide techniques and apparatus for improved machine learning. Voice data from a first user is received. In response to determining that the voice data includes an utterance of a defined keyword, a user verification score is generated by processing the voice data using a first user verification machine learning (ML) model, and a quality of the voice data is determined. In response to determining that the user verification score and determined quality satisfy one or more defined criteria, a second user verification ML model is updated based on the voice data.Type: ApplicationFiled: September 23, 2022Publication date: March 28, 2024Inventors: Hesu HUANG, Leonid SHEYNBLAT, Vinesh SUKUMAR, Ziad ASGHAR, Joel LINSKY, Justin MCGLOIN, Tong TANG
-
Publication number: 20240104420Abstract: Certain aspects of the present disclosure provide techniques and apparatus for a training and using machine learning models in multi-device network environments. An example computer-implemented method for network communications performed by a host device includes extracting a feature set from a data set associated with a client device using a client-device-specific feature extractor, wherein the feature set comprises a subset of features in a common feature space, training a task-specific model based on the extracted feature set and one or more other feature sets associated with other client devices, wherein the feature sets associated with the other client devices comprise one or more subsets of features in the common feature space, and deploying, to each respective client device of a plurality of client devices, a respective version of the task-specific model.Type: ApplicationFiled: September 23, 2022Publication date: March 28, 2024Inventors: Kyu Woong HWANG, Seunghan YANG, Hyunsin PARK, Leonid SHEYNBLAT, Vinesh SUKUMAR, Ziad ASGHAR, Justin MCGLOIN, Joel LINSKY, Tong TANG
-
Publication number: 20240073935Abstract: Various embodiments include methods and implementing computing devices, for distributing compute operation across connected wired or wireless computing devices. Various embodiments may include establishing an ad hoc communication connection with a second computing device, in which the ad hoc communication connection is part of a network of a plurality of wired or wireless computing devices communicatively connected via a plurality of ad hoc communication connections, receiving context information of the second wired or computing device via the ad hoc communication connection, selecting at least one sensor wired or wireless computing device from the plurality of wired or wireless computing devices, selecting at least one execution wired or wireless computing device from the plurality of wired or wireless computing devices, assigning a data gathering part of a work item to the sensor computing device, and assigning an execution part of the work item to the execution wired or wireless computing device.Type: ApplicationFiled: August 30, 2022Publication date: February 29, 2024Inventors: Philippe DECOTIGNIE, Shishir GUPTA, Ziad ASGHAR, Paul TORRES, Leonid SHEYNBLAT, Miran CHUN
-
Publication number: 20230106673Abstract: Systems, methods, and non-transitory media are provided for a vehicle and mobile device interface for vehicle occupant assistance. An example method can include determining, based on one or more images of an interior portion of a vehicle, a pose of a mobile device relative to a coordinate system of the vehicle; determine a state of an occupant of the vehicle; and send, to the vehicle, data indicating the state of the occupant and the pose of the mobile device relative to the coordinate system of the vehicle.Type: ApplicationFiled: October 6, 2021Publication date: April 6, 2023Inventors: Ziad ASGHAR, Wesley James HOLLAND, Seyfullah Halit OGUZ, Bala RAMASAMY, Leonid SHEYNBLAT
-
Patent number: 11562550Abstract: Systems, methods, and non-transitory media are provided for a vehicle and mobile device interface for vehicle occupant assistance. An example method can include determining, based on one or more images of an interior portion of a vehicle, a position of a mobile device relative to a coordinate system of the vehicle; receiving, from the vehicle, data associated with one or more sensors of the vehicle; and displaying, using a display device of the mobile device, virtual content based on the data associated with the one or more sensors and the position of the mobile device relative to the coordinate system of the vehicle.Type: GrantFiled: October 6, 2021Date of Patent: January 24, 2023Assignee: QUALCOMM IncorporatedInventors: Ziad Asghar, Wesley James Holland, Seyfullah Halit Oguz, Bala Ramasamy, Leonid Sheynblat
-
Patent number: 10365647Abstract: In general, techniques are described for ensuring occupant awareness in vehicles. A device comprising a processor may be configured to perform the techniques. The processor may be configured to determine an event which will change an operating characteristic of the vehicle, and determine an extent of time remaining until an estimated occurrence of the expected event. The processor may also be configured to determine a process by which to inform the occupant of an operating context of the vehicle based on the determined extent of time remaining until the estimated occurrence the expected event, and perform the process by which to inform the occupant of the operating context of the vehicle. The device may also include a memory configured to store the process.Type: GrantFiled: March 29, 2017Date of Patent: July 30, 2019Assignee: QUALCOMM IncorporatedInventors: Ziad Asghar, Regan Blythe Towal
-
Publication number: 20180284764Abstract: In general, techniques are described for ensuring occupant awareness in vehicles. A device comprising a processor may be configured to perform the techniques. The processor may be configured to determine an event which will change an operating characteristic of the vehicle, and determine an extent of time remaining until an estimated occurrence of the expected event. The processor may also be configured to determine a process by which to inform the occupant of an operating context of the vehicle based on the determined extent of time remaining until the estimated occurrence the expected event, and perform the process by which to inform the occupant of the operating context of the vehicle. The device may also include a memory configured to store the process.Type: ApplicationFiled: March 29, 2017Publication date: October 4, 2018Inventors: Ziad Asghar, Regan Blythe Towal
-
Patent number: 7796649Abstract: System and method for providing additional channels to an existing communications system. A preferred embodiment comprises a coprocessor (such as coprocessor 215) coupled to a modem (such as modem 205), wherein transmissions from the modem are routed to the coprocessor. The coprocessor then can insert transmissions that use the additional channels into the transmission from the modem. Timing consistency can be ensured by the coprocessor using scrambling and channelization codes that are provided by the modem. The use of the coprocessor can allow the use of an existing design for the modem rather than creating a new design when a revision to a technical standard is released, saving time and money for equipment manufacturers.Type: GrantFiled: February 18, 2004Date of Patent: September 14, 2010Assignee: Texas Instruments IncorporatedInventors: Gibong Jeong, Ziad Asghar
-
Patent number: 7600179Abstract: A method is provided to decode data encoded by any block code in a manner that substantially improves the error correction capability of the block codes, and that is independent of the encoder. The structure associated with the method desirably allows the testing of those hypotheses that are known to exist, such that one can use the a priori knowledge of the possible set of hypotheses to only search from among them. The method of decoding data is both advantageous and desirable since knowing the subset of the code word space that is being utilized in essence allows the distance between the code words to be increased yielding significant decoding benefits.Type: GrantFiled: June 23, 2003Date of Patent: October 6, 2009Assignee: Texas Instruments IncorporatedInventors: Ziad Asghar, Gibong Jeong
-
Patent number: 7386030Abstract: System and method for improving the detection performance of a wirelessly transmitted signal. A preferred embodiment comprises specifying a desired response for missed channel detection and false alarm probabilities for a plurality of signal qualities and determining if a channel detection threshold is based on missed channel detection or false alarm probabilities for the plurality of signal qualities. A signal quality estimate of a channel can be inferred from a signal quality measurement of a second channel, wherein the channel and the second channel are sourced by a single transmitter. The channel detection threshold can be adjusted based upon the previously determined required response and the signal quality estimate of the channel.Type: GrantFiled: July 6, 2004Date of Patent: June 10, 2008Assignee: Texas Instruments IncorporatedInventors: Ziad Asghar, Gibong Jeong, Ashwin Sampath
-
Publication number: 20050180384Abstract: System and method for providing additional channels to an existing communications system. A preferred embodiment comprises a coprocessor (such as coprocessor 215) coupled to a modem (such as modem 205), wherein transmissions from the modem are routed to the coprocessor. The coprocessor then can insert transmissions that use the additional channels into the transmission from the modem. Timing consistency can be ensured by the coprocessor using scrambling and channelization codes that are provided by the modem. The use of the coprocessor can allow the use of an existing design for the modem rather than creating a new design when a revision to a technical standard is released, saving time and money for equipment manufacturers.Type: ApplicationFiled: February 18, 2004Publication date: August 18, 2005Inventors: Gibong Jeong, Ziad Asghar
-
Publication number: 20050181731Abstract: System and method for improving the detection performance of a wirelessly transmitted signal. A preferred embodiment comprises specifying a desired response for missed channel detection and false alarm probabilities for a plurality of signal qualities and determining if a channel detection threshold is based on missed channel detection or false alarm probabilities for the plurality of signal qualities. A signal quality estimate of a channel can be inferred from a signal quality measurement of a second channel, wherein the channel and the second channel are sourced by a single transmitter. The channel detection threshold can be adjusted based upon the previously determined required response and the signal quality estimate of the channel.Type: ApplicationFiled: July 6, 2004Publication date: August 18, 2005Inventors: Ziad Asghar, Gibong Jeong, Ashwin Sampath